Output 51c2f72ed3635bfe5528297fb658d61e61ca82cb8e36cdc28df6567b34273d6e:0

value
203472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2103584883b6dda939373f3c967be2a6dacfbf77 OP_EQUAL
address
34haEH8LgSVuXqJzqWEEhM8hDi172ZWqEx
transaction
51c2f72ed3635bfe5528297fb658d61e61ca82cb8e36cdc28df6567b34273d6e
spent
true